Keep them in a plastic storage bin, provide them some sort of heat source to keep it in the mid-80's. I blend a mix of greens, fruit, seeds, water and other things that are safe for them to eat and freeze it in ice cube trays, then thaw it out and put it in there with them every other day. You can also feed them dry mixes that contain things like chicken feed and fish food among other things. There are lots of recipes online. Provide them with water crystals or a wet sponge as a water source because they will drown in a bowl of water.

For heat you should use a heat mat or you could use a ceramic heat emitter if you set it up properly without melting the bin but heat tape or a heating pad is your best option.

The problem with those quenchers is it has added calcium in them ... what I do is I get the water crystals from lowes or home depot miracle grow is the brand.. all you do is add water.. You don't want too much calcium..
Just remember what you feed your dubia you will be feeding your beardie so make sure all is good..so leftover salad/greens, stems off of your collards..

What I would do is stack the egg flats on 1 end of your container standing them up so the frass (poop) falls to the bottom (make sure you leave the frass for them to eat and burrow in) and on the other end put lids to like mayo/peanut butter jars and put the crystals in 1 dry chow in 1 and your greens/veggies in another..if you leave the food on the egg flats they will get wet and can get moldy which will kill your colony

I have 4 tubs.. 1 is my breeder colony 1 are all my extra females 1 are all my males 1 is my nymphs.. I only want my breeders producing as I have soo many...so by separating them you can control that..I also will rotate out some adults to give them breaks or if a male looks beat up I'll change him out to let him re coup.
